In contrast to critical systems, one of the primary consequences of faults in HVAC systems is economic rather than safety-related. Therefore, FDD systems applied to HVAC systems must be assessed based upon economic considerations. Viral metagenomic analysis of he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) filters recovered the near-complete genome sequence of a novel virus, named HVAC-associated RNA virus 1 (HVAC-RV1). The HVAC-RV1 genome is most similar to those of picorna-like viruses identified in arthropods but encodes a small domain observed only in negative-sense single-stranded RNA viruses.
